A day after Aaron Sivale requested a business, Milvauki Broovers sent a right -handed batsman to the Chicago White Sox on Friday.

Many outlets reported the deal, in which the first Basman Andrew Vaughan went to the brooers in exchange for the pitcher.

Sivale lost his early role to the top prospect Jacob Misiorowski, who threw five no-in innings at the beginning of a dazzle on Thursday to defeat St. Louis Cardinals.

After the team informed Sivale that he was going to Bulpen, his agent, Jack Toffee made a business request to Bruce’s General Manager Matt Arnold.

“The conversation was very professional,” Toffee said according to the athletic on Thursday. “I just said very respectfully that Aaron would really like the opportunity to continue his career as a starter. He is going to be a free agent at the end of the year.”

Toffee said that Sewale was not dissatisfied, but was only examining his options.

“Aaron is not angry or beating his fist on the table,” said Toffee. “But it’s a little confusing because he has not made his way out of the rotation. It is a subjective option that the organization is creating.”

On Thursday, at the age of 30, Sivale recorded all 122 performances of his regular session as a starter. He came out of the Bulpen in the game 1 defeat of the 2024 National League Wild-Card Series against New York Mets, throwing three scorer innings.

This season with Civale Milwauki is 1-2 with 4.91 ERA in this season. He is 40–37 with 4.06 ERA in his career with Cleveland (2019–23), Tampa Bay Raz (2023–24) and Broverns, who did business for him in the last July.

The 27-year-old Vaughan was dumped in Triple-e-Charlett last month.

Vaughan batted with 77 Homeers and 293 RBI in 610 games as White Sox had a third draft in total in the 2019 MLB draft.
